Ludwig van Beethoven, known to me as The Man, once said, "Don't only practice your art, but force your way into its secrets; art deserves that, for it and knowledge can raise man to the Divine".

When I read this I immediately thought about the day I applied to Recording Connection. It was kind of a hard step. I'm used to playing the game by my own rules. I'm a free spirit musician. And by that I mean I don't force myself to sight read my piano or even read notes anymore... I just feel it and write what needs to get out of me. Expression. Extension. An expression and extension of the soul. That's what music is. So as musicians, we have the obligation to push ourselves just a little bit more. So here I am, setting goals. We owe it to ourselves to accomplish everything we've dreamed of and more. We OWE it to Beethoven!
